What Is a Urine Drug Screen?

In Strawn, TX, the process of analyzing urine specimens for the presence of drugs and their breakdown products is known as a urine drug screen (UDS). This method has become the primary choice for organizations due to its minimally invasive nature, affordability, and the ability to identify a broad spectrum of substances over an effective time frame.

  • Collected under strict chain-of-custody conditions for regulated environments.
  • Capable of detecting both parent drugs and their metabolites excreted through urine.
  • Shows previous exposure during a detection window, and does not indicate current intoxication or impairment.

Why Organizations Use Urine Drug Screening

  • A crucial tool in Strawn, TX: pre-employment drug screening aids in fostering a secure and drug-free work environment.
  • Incorporates diverse testing scenarios such as random checks, post-incident evaluations, suspicion-based tests, and assessments for returning employees.
  • Ensures compliance with stringent regulations in industries where safety is paramount.
  • Monitors compliance with prescribed medication regimes or treatment initiatives.

How It Works

Collection

Testing Methodology

Interpreting Results

  • In Strawn, TX, the initial immunoassay screening offers a rapid and cost-effective assessment of drugs.
  • Presumptive positives undergo confirmatory testing methods such as GC/MS or LC/MS/MS for reliable validation.
  • Established cutoff concentrations, noted in ng/mL, determine whether results are positive or negative.

Detection Windows

The duration drugs remain detectable is influenced by factors such as substance type, consumption frequency, individual metabolism, hydration levels, body composition, and testing sensitivity. Generally, drugs are detectable for 1–3 days, although substances like cannabinoids in regular users may linger longer.

What Is a Hair Drug Screen?

In Strawn, TX, hair drug screening involves the analysis of a small sample of hair to uncover drug use and their metabolites, which are transported within the bloodstream and permanently embedded in hair shafts. Due to the hair's slow growth rate and its ability to store drug metabolites for extended periods, this method offers one of the longest detection intervals, ideal for identifying habitual or long-standing substance use.

  • Typically involves collecting 100–120 strands of hair cut close to the scalp, around 1.5 inches in length.
  • Captures approximately 90 days of potential drug exposure, depending on the hair's length.
  • Effective across a wide array of substances such as amphetamines, opioids, cocaine, marijuana, and PCP.

How It Works

Collection

  • In Strawn, TX, a small hair sample (often from the crown) is carefully trimmed, adhering to chain-of-custody standards.
  • The gathered sample is sealed, labeled, and sent to a certified laboratory for analysis.
  • Should scalp hair be unavailable, other collection sites, such as body hair, might be used.

Testing Methodology

  • Samples undergo comprehensive washing and preparation to eliminate any potential external contamination.
  • Preliminary screening processes apply immunoassay technologies to detect various drug classes.
  • Positive initial screenings are thoroughly confirmed using GC/MS or LC/MS/MS techniques for accurate identification.
  • Set cutoff levels are defined using nanograms per milligram (ng/mg), adhering to SAMHSA and lab standards.

Interpreting Results

  • Negative: Strawn, TX's hair analysis detects no drugs or metabolites exceeding laboratory-established cutoffs.
  • Positive: In Strawn, TX, drugs or metabolites that exceed cutoff levels are verified through a secondary confirmatory test.
  • Inconclusive/Rejected: In situations with inadequate samples or contamination concerns, recollection might be necessary within Strawn, TX procedures.

Detection Windows

Offering the most extended detection window among all testing methods available in Strawn, TX, a standard 1.5-inch hair sample signifies roughly 90 days of potential drug exposure. Extended hair samples can increase this window, subject to growth rate (roughly 0.5 inches per month). Unlike other tests like urine or oral fluid, hair analysis cannot detect the most recent drug use (typically within 7–10 days).

Key Considerations for Regulated and Non-Regulated Testing

  • Though DOT regulations do not currently mandate hair testing, ongoing assessments by the Department of Transportation and HHS might lead to future adoption of these guidelines.
  • For non-DOT initiatives, hair testing is widely recognized as an efficient long-term detection tool.
  • Trained professionals should execute every collection under documented chain-of-custody practice.
  • Labs must possess SAMHSA or CAP/CLIA certification to ensure precision and reliability.

Benefits

  • Offers a prolonged detection window, extending up to 90 days or more.
  • Compared to urine samples, hair samples are challenging to tamper with or substitute.
  • Provides a comprehensive pattern highlighting chronic or repetitive substance abuse.
  • Collection is swift, non-invasive, and doesn't require a restroom facility.
